Canadian citizens enjoy visa exemption for Thailand (up to 60 days; passport valid 6+ months). No vaccinations required but recommended: Hepatitis A/B, Typhoid. Flight costs vary widely ($850–$2,200+ round-trip depending on season, airline and booking time). No direct flights from YUL; all involve 1–2 stops. Main arrival airport: Phuket International (HKT). Dry season (Nov–Apr) is ideal for first-time visitors from Montreal. Shoulder months (May, Oct) offer excellent value. Check forecast via Legend Travel Group support.
